The Valine, 2-methyl- is an organic compound with the formula C6H13NO2. The systematic name of this chemical is 3-methylisovaline. With the CAS registry number 26287-62-7, it is also named as Methyl valine. The product's category is Glycinescaffold.
Physical properties about Valine, 2-methyl- are: (1)ACD/LogP: 0.55; (2)ACD/BCF (pH 5.5): 1; (3)ACD/BCF (pH 7.4): 1; (4)ACD/KOC (pH 5.5): 1; (5)ACD/KOC (pH 7.4): 1; (6)#H bond acceptors: 3; (7)#H bond donors: 3; (8)#Freely Rotating Bonds: 3; (9)Polar Surface Area: 29.54 Å2; (10)Index of Refraction: 1.464; (11)Molar Refractivity: 34.87 cm3; (12)Molar Volume: 126.3 cm3; (13)Polarizability: 13.82×10-24cm3; (14)Surface Tension: 38.2 dyne/cm; (15)Density: 1.038 g/cm3; (16)Flash Point: 85.5 °C; (17)Enthalpy of Vaporization: 50.03 kJ/mol; (18)Boiling Point: 217.7 °C at 760 mmHg; (19)Vapour Pressure: 0.0499 mmHg at 25°C.
Uses of Valine, 2-methyl-: it can be used to produce 2-benzyloxycarbonylamino-2,3-dimethyl-butyric acid benzyl ester at temperature of 50 °C. It will need reagents 4-(dimethylamino)pyridine, NEt3 and solvent dimethylsulfoxide with reaction time of 1.5 hours. The yield is about 41%.
